I received the MT5634ZBA-V92 yesterday, and have spent the better part of two days trying to figure out how to get it to work with adaptive answer as it needs to accept data calls as well as faxes. The only thing I've found that gets data calls to work is to use ``ModemSetupAACmd: AT%A1+FAA=1'' which causes HylaFAX to hand data connections off to getty properly. Unfortunately fax calls then fail. If I leave out ModemSetupAACmd, faxes are handled properly, but data calls fail. I have tried various combinations of ModemAnswerCmd, ModemAnswerDataCmd, and ModemAnswerFaxCmd with no success. I've tried Class1RecvIdentTimer, AdaptiveAnswer, and AnswerRotary, but these never handed data calls off to getty. We have distinctive lines with two phone numbers coming into the fax modem so I tried DistinctiveRings, with DRingOn and DRingOff, which would come up with things like ``WFR: received cadence 20, 0, 0, 0, 0'', ``ANSWER: Ring detected without successful handshake'' even though I had DistintiveRings ``D-20,F-8'' which I think should have been a data call.
